API-ReferenzGET
Alert-Einstellungen abrufen
Liest E-Mail-Alert-Einstellungen für neue relevante Mentions.
GET
https://ai.redreplier.com/ai-app/api/v1/alert-settingsLiest E-Mail-Alert-Einstellungen für neue relevante Mentions.
Bearer-Token (RedReplier-API-Token)
Authentifizierung
Sende bei jeder Anfrage ein RedReplier-API-Token als Bearer-Token. Tokens beginnen mit redreplier_; RedReplier ermittelt das Konto aus dem Token.
Authorization: Bearer redreplier_test_1234567890
Content-Type: application/jsonParameter
Dieser Endpoint hat keine Pfad- oder Query-Parameter.
Request-Body
Dieser Endpoint benötigt keinen JSON-Body.
Antwort
Gibt Alert-Einstellungen für das Token-Konto zurück.
enabled(boolean): Gibt an, ob E-Mail-Alerts aktiviert sind.cadenceMinutes(number): Konfigurierte Alert-Kadenz in Minuten.minIntervalMinutes(number): Schnellste vom aktuellen Tarif erlaubte Kadenz.availableCadences(number[]): Für den aktuellen Tarif verfügbare Kadenzwerte.
Beispielanfrage
curl -s https://ai.redreplier.com/ai-app/api/v1/alert-settings \
-H 'Authorization: Bearer redreplier_test_1234567890'Hinweise
minIntervalMinutes ist die schnellste vom aktuellen Tarif erlaubte Kadenz.
Fehler
400 Bad Request: Ungültige Eingabe, URL, UUID, Enum, Query-Parameter oder Body.401 Unauthorized: Fehlendes oder ungültiges Bearer-Token.404 Not Found: Die Ressource existiert nicht für das Token-Konto.500 Internal Server Error: Unerwarteter Serverfehler.
Beispielanfrage (curl)
curl --request GET \
--url https://ai.redreplier.com/ai-app/api/v1/alert-settings \
--header 'Authorization: Bearer redreplier_test_1234567890'200
{
"enabled": true,
"cadenceMinutes": 240,
"minIntervalMinutes": 60,
"availableCadences": [60, 240, 720, 1440]
}